Allens West to Hyde North by train

A train trip from Allens West to Hyde North takes about 4hrs 11 mins on average, covering roughly 78 miles (127 kilometres). With around 20 trains running each day, there's plenty of flexibility for your travel plans. If you book in advance, you can grab tickets starting from just £68.60, making it a budget-friendly option for those who plan ahead.

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Everything you need to know about Allens West Station

Welcome to Allens West Train Station

Nestled in the heart of County Durham, Allens West train station serves as a humble yet vital hub for everyday commuters and travelers in the Teesside region. Whether you're a local resident looking to travel for work, or a visitor aiming to explore the vibrant North East of England, Allens West station offers a practical starting point for your journey.

Facilities and Amenities

Allens West is a modest station equipped with essential facilities aimed at ensuring a smooth transit experience. Though it does not have a ticket office or staffed help, ticket machines are available for purchasing and collecting train tickets. Smartcard holders are in luck, as issuance is possible here, although there's no validator present. The station is dedicated to passenger safety and convenience—with CCTV monitoring and an induction loop available for those with hearing impairments.

Accessibility wise, the station supports step-free access making it a Category B station, thus ensuring ease of movement for wheelchair users. Assistance for passengers with mobility needs can be sought directly on the platform. There are no public restrooms or refreshment facilities, so it's best to prepare ahead if embarking on a long journey.

Onward Travel Options

The station is conveniently linked to various modes of transport. Visitors will find a rail replacement service operating adjacent to the level crossing. For those needing a taxi, bookings can be made easily via a handy online service, offering connectivity to the surrounding areas. Unfortunately, bicycle hire is not available directly at the station, but secured storage for personal bicycles is provided.

Further support for your onward journey can be obtained from detailed printable resources, ensuring you're never left stranded.

Everything you need to know about Hyde North Station

Welcome to Hyde North Train Station

Nestled in the heart of Tameside, Greater Manchester, Hyde North train station serves as a key local transport hub located within commutable distance to Manchester. It's a point of convenience for travellers looking to journey across the UK with a bit more ease and local flair. Hyde North station may not be as large as some of its neighbouring counterparts, but its simplicity and locale make it a preferred choice for many commuters. Whether you're a frequent traveller or planning a leisurely trip, this article covers everything you need to know about Hyde North station's facilities, travel connections, and exciting destinations.

Facilities and Amenities at Hyde North

While Hyde North station does not boast the full suite of amenities some larger stations might offer, it does provide essential services to assist in your travel. Ticket collection is streamlined with accessible machines located on Platform 1, perfect for those who have purchased tickets online and need a quick pickup. However, there is no ticket office available. The station aids those with hearing impairments using an induction loop system.

Interestingly, while Hyde North lacks a staffed help center, passengers are encouraged to call 08002006060 for any assistance. CCTV and the presence of staff may be absent, but a free-of-charge car park with 15 spots is convenient for those driving to the station. Additionally, while no food outlets can be found within the station, its proximity to the town offers various eateries nearby.

Accessibility and Travel Support

Hyde North station is categorised under category C for accessibility. Passengers can reach Platform 1 directly from the car park, although access to services toward Rose Hill requires traversing a bridge with stairs. Despite the relative limitations in accessibility, additional support and assistance are easily requested through the Passenger Assist service, ensuring no traveler is left behind. Hyde North enables travel without the stress of prior booking through National Rail's assistance services, with more details found here.

Onward Travel Connections

Hyde North is nestled in a prime location that facilitates easy access to several travel modes. Rail replacement services can be accessed outside the station entrance on Junction Street. The station offers bus connections at Junction Street towards popular destinations like Stockport and Ashton, with further details available via Busline at 0871 200 2233.

While direct taxi services aren't stationed, Northern Railway's cab4you service enables easy booking. For metro connections, details can be found through GMPTE by calling 0161 228 7811, though Hyde North does not have its own bicycle hire service.
